Hot zone
The hot zone is the area that starts six (6) spaces before the right margin and
extends to the right margin. A warning beep will sound when the hot zone is
reached_ If you are typing a word that is too long to fit into the hot zone, you will
have to either divide the word by using a hyphen, or shift the whole word to the
next line.
Returning the carrier
Returning the carrier to the left margin advances the paper by the number of
lines set with the line space selector (1, 1 1/2, 2). This machine is provided with
an automatic carder return function which, when activated, will return the carrier
automatically when you type a space or a hyphen in the hot zone.
Pressing [ALTI + [OPERATE]
switches through the following "OPERATE"
options:
OFF (not displayed)-.) AUTO _
L/L -_, OFF
Indication
Meaning
OFF
Printingmode, manual return only (typist must press
[RETURN].)
AUTO
(A)
Printing mode, auto carrier return function activated
L/L
(V)
Display mode (line-byqine), auto carrier return
activated
